Market depth and operator structure

FanDuel Sportsbook

FanDuel Sportsbook operates as a fully licensed digital and retail bookmaker across dozens of regulated United States jurisdictions. Owned by Flutter Entertainment, the platform specializes in mainstream professional and collegiate athletic competitions. Players can access extensive wagering menus covering the NFL, NBA, MLB, NHL, college football, college basketball, soccer, tennis, golf, and combat sports, alongside select international events.

The platform is widely recognized for popularizing the same game parlay format, enabling bettors to combine point spreads, totals, and diverse player proposition markets within a single contest. Live in-play wagering menus refresh dynamically, offering point-by-point or drive-by-drive betting opportunities throughout active broadcasts. Market depth on second tier competitions or international leagues is somewhat more restrained, reflecting the platform primary orientation toward North American sports enthusiasts.

Retail sportsbook installations in partner casinos and racetracks complement the digital apps, providing physical betting terminals and cashiers in select legal states. Digital betting rules, allowable wager types, and maximum payout boundaries adhere strictly to state gaming board guidelines, ensuring standard operational oversight across all available markets.

ZEbet

ZEbet operates primarily as a fixed-odds online sports betting operator licensed to serve adult residents in France. The platform focuses heavily on European sports competitions, with comprehensive pre-match and in-play markets available for Ligue 1, UEFA Champions League, top domestic European football divisions, ATP and WTA tennis tours, and major international basketball fixtures. Minor sports such as rugby, handball, cycling, and motorsport also receive regular board coverage when seasonal events are active.

Market depth on headline football fixtures typically includes standard match outcome wagering, total goals over or under lines, both teams to score options, Asian handicaps, and specific player proposition markets. In-play betting interfaces refresh odds promptly during live fixtures, accompanied by graphical match tracking and relevant statistical data feeds. While niche international sports and novel prop categories are restricted by ANJ catalog rules, the operator delivers extensive depth across sanctioned competitive categories.

Odds structure, promotions, and bonus rules

FanDuel Sportsbook

Pricing across core spreads and totals on major professional sports typically reflects a standard twenty-cent market baseline, representing approximately 4.76 percent implied bookmaker margin. Derivative lines, player props, and deep alternate spreads carry higher house margins, which is customary across retail and digital wagering outlets. Bettors can take advantage of daily profit boosts, odds boosts on featured events, and parlay insurance promotions that soften pricing on multi-leg tickets.

Introductory welcome offers generally require a qualifying real-money deposit and an initial settled wager, often awarding promotional bonus bets if specific criteria are fulfilled. These bonus funds remain subject to strict conditions: bonus bets are non-withdrawable, carry a one-time wagering playthrough requirement, and expire if unused within seven to fourteen days depending on current terms.

When a bet placed with bonus credit wins, the payout includes only the net winnings, omitting the original bonus stake value. Certain bet types, such as early cashout transactions or bets placed below minimum specified odds, may void promotional eligibility. Bettors should review active state-specific promo terms before committing funds to helps support their intended strategy aligns with bonus clearing rules.

ZEbet

Odds pricing on ZEbet generally sits around market averages for regulated French bookmakers, where state gaming taxes impact overall gross margins across the sector. Payout percentages tend to be strongest on high-profile European football matches and Grand Slam tennis encounters, whereas secondary markets and niche sports carry wider house margins. Bettors can construct single selections, accumulators, and system bets using standard bet slip tools.

Promotional incentives and onboarding offers on ZEbet conform strictly to ANJ advertising and consumer protection guidelines. Welcome packages and free bet promotions generally involve transparent qualification steps, such as placing an initial qualifying wager at minimum stated odds. Bonus funds are typically credited as non-withdrawable promotional credits where only the net winnings are eligible for withdrawal after standard settlement, preventing ambiguous rollover spirals often seen on unregulated platforms.

Deposit options, withdrawal speeds, and payout limits

FanDuel Sportsbook

FanDuel Sportsbook accommodates a broad range of domestic funding methods, including online banking through Trustly, debit cards, PayPal, Venmo, Apple Pay, wire transfers, prepaid cards, and cash at participating retail casino cages. Most deposit methods reflect in account balances instantly with a standard ten dollar minimum threshold. The operator charges no internal processing fees for deposits or standard withdrawals, though personal banking institutions may assess intermediary charges.

Payout requests undergo internal security and compliance reviews prior to release. Electronic withdrawals to debit cards, PayPal, and Venmo frequently clear within several hours of approval, while online bank transfers and ACH payouts generally settle within two to three business days. Physical check delivery by mail requires up to seven to ten business days.

Withdrawal limits accommodate both recreational bettors and higher-volume participants, though very large sums may be divided into installment payouts or require additional verification checks. Payout processing speeds depend on the selected channel, bank settlement schedules, and whether the account profile has completed required identity confirmations.

ZEbet

Account funding on ZEbet is supported through familiar payment methods including Visa, Mastercard, Carte Bancaire, prepaid vouchers such as Paysafecard, and popular digital wallets like PayPal and Skrill. Deposit transactions are processed instantly without operator fees, allowing immediate access to wagering balances. Minimum deposit thresholds are set at accessible levels, accommodating recreational bankrolls comfortably.

In strict compliance with French gambling legislation, withdrawal transactions are executed exclusively via direct bank wire transfers to a validated personal bank account held in the player's name. Users must complete full Know Your Customer (KYC) identity verification by submitting proof of identity and an official bank identification document (RIB) before cashouts can be approved. Standard bank transfer processing times usually range between two to four working days once internal approvals are finalized.

Regulatory licensing, account safety, and customer care

FanDuel Sportsbook

FanDuel Sportsbook maintains formal licenses issued by state gambling authorities, including the New Jersey Division of Gaming Enforcement, the New York State Gaming Commission, the Pennsylvania Gaming Control Board, and the Ohio Casino Control Commission. Compliance requirements mandate stringent Know Your Customer verification procedures, requiring submission of legal name, physical address, date of birth, and Social Security digits during registration.

Account security architecture incorporates optional two-factor authentication, biometric login on supported mobile devices, and automated device tracking. Geolocation software verifies that the user is physically positioned inside an authorized state border during wager placement. VPN usage, remote desktop software, or location-masking tools automatically trigger access blocks to prevent unauthorized cross-border betting.

Customer support services operate through automated live chat bots, human representative escalation, email ticketing, and a structured online knowledge base. While standard account inquiries and payment clarifications resolve smoothly, complex settlement reviews or identity escalations during peak sporting events can experience queue delays. Phone support is primarily handled via scheduled callbacks rather than direct inbound lines.

ZEbet

ZEbet operates under an official sports betting license issued by the Autorite Nationale des Jeux (ANJ) in France. This licensing regime mandates segregated player account balances, stringent data privacy compliance under European GDPR standards, and strict technical audits of transaction integrity. The regulatory structure ensures that player balances are protected independently from general operating capital, establishing strong consumer safety fundamentals.

Customer support services on ZEbet are accessible through multiple direct contact options, including an online ticket submission system, direct email assistance, and a structured frequently asked questions database. During peak European sporting hours, responsive assistance is available to resolve bet settlement questions, identity document validation issues, and account settings. While round-the-clock telephone coverage is not maintained, standard daytime inquiries are handled effectively.

State availability and jurisdictional restrictions

FanDuel Sportsbook

FanDuel Sportsbook operates strictly within legal, regulated United States jurisdictions. Availability extends across more than twenty states, including New York, New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Michigan, Ohio, Illinois, Virginia, Arizona, and Colorado, as well as Ontario, Canada under local iGaming regulations. Access is strictly forbidden from non-regulated states or foreign territories, and software continuously monitors IP and GPS signals.

Wagering rules also differ regionally due to local statutory limits. For instance, certain jurisdictions prohibit individual player proposition bets on college athletes or disallow betting on in-state collegiate programs entirely. Bettors traveling across state lines must adapt to local catalog differences and helps support their active location aligns with operational territories.

ZEbet

ZEbet delivers regulated online wagering services tailored specifically to adult sports bettors residing within jurisdictions authorized under its official licensing framework, predominantly the French domestic market. To create and maintain an active wagering account, applicants must be at least eighteen years of age, provide verifiable government-issued identification, and hold a valid bank account within an authorized jurisdiction. Automated geolocation tools and rigorous identity verification protocols actively block access from non-eligible international territories, ensuring consistent alignment with cross-border legal restrictions and national gaming mandates. Account holders who relocate outside authorized jurisdictions lose real-money wagering privileges, reflecting the operator's strict commitment to compliance with all applicable statutory and regulatory licensing conditions established by national oversight authorities.

Responsible gaming tools and limit settings

FanDuel Sportsbook

The platform provides integrated responsible gaming controls enabling users to manage their wagering activity proactively. Players can configure customizable deposit limits, wager limits, and session time reminders directly within their account profile settings. Reductions in limits apply immediately, whereas limit increases require a cooling-off waiting period before taking effect.

For players needing a formal pause, FanDuel offers short-term timeout periods ranging from several days to several weeks, alongside long-term self-exclusion programs coordinated through state regulatory registries. These tools prevent marketing communications and suspend wagering access across all connected platform services for the duration of the exclusion term.

ZEbet

In compliance with rigorous French regulatory standards, ZEbet integrates comprehensive responsible gambling mechanisms directly into the initial onboarding flow and persistent profile settings. Every newly registered bettor is required by law to define binding parameters, including weekly deposit maximums, wagering thresholds, and automatic balance withdrawal limits. The interface provides instantaneous self-control utilities such as automated session timers, voluntary cooling-off intervals, and customizable temporary account suspensions. Furthermore, the operator maintains direct integration with national exclusion databases managed by regulatory bodies, enabling players to initiate binding self-exclusion whenever necessary. These protective tools empower sports bettors to manage their gaming activity systematically within pre-established, sustainable financial boundaries.
